i've got the CST 4" spindles that greg installed...
however, in addition to that are SAWs with an additional 0-5"s of lift. so currently at about 6.5" - 7" of total front lift.

Wut was the advice greg gave you? im just curious because im thinking about the 4" lift
Greg suggested that if I were not sure about doing a 6" lift, go for a 4" CST spindle lift and if at some point I wanted to go higher, it would be easy to add more lift. The CST spindle kit is a great starting point. I have been very happy with the result. I will end up adding 2 more inches at some point, but for now, it looks good with the 4" lift. Hope this helps.
